October's guest event
Despite fierce competition with the political debate on Tuesday the 7th of October, there was a full meeting room at the library for the Kachemacs guest event. Andrew Welch, president of Ambrosia Software came all the way from New York State to show and tell some of the products available from his company. It was such an opportunity to meet a Mac developer in person at one of our meetings way up here in Homer.
Andrew provided us with many copies of the demo DVD with all the company’s software on it to use for free for 30 days. I have plenty of extras if anyone missed out.
